Regional Workshop on Disaster Risk Reduction 2020

News Date : 08 Feb, 2020

The Regional Workshop of Disaster Risk Reduction (DRR) was held at Hotel Mayfair today. It will continue for 2 days. The inaugural sessions keynote was delivered by Sri GVV Sarma, IAS Member Secretary, NDMA. The workshop was graced by the kind presence of Sri Pradeep Jena, IAS, Additional Chief Secretary, Odisha & MD, OSDMA and Sri Sandeep Poundrik, IAS, Joint Secretary (Mitigation), NDMA. Dr. Aurobindo Behera, IAS (Retd.) graced the occasion as Guest of Honour. This workshop is expected to help the concerned states in planning the disaster risk reduction measures in better way which will contribute the overall risk reduction thereby the losses due to natural disasters in the country.

Day One: (10.02.2020)

The 1st Technical session of Regional Workshop on DRR i.e., Cyclone & Tsunami Risk Reduction was chaired by Sri GVV Sarma, IAS Member Secretary, NDMA. Four presentations were made on the theme like National Cyclone Risk Mitigation Project by Sri S Kumar, Deputy Project Director, NDMA followed by Cyclone Early Warning System in the Country by Ms. Sunitha Devi, Scientist E, IMD and Dr. EP Rama Rao, Scientist F INCOIS, Hyderabad made a presentation on Tsunami Early Warning System in the Country. Sri P.K Jena, Additional Chief Secretary & MD OSDMA gave a presentation on Cyclone Risk Reduction Measures taken by Odisha.

The theme for the 2nd Technical session of Regional Workshop on DRR i.e., Earthquake Risk and Mitigation Measures was chaired by Sri P.K Jena, ACS & MD OSDMA. Three presentations were made on the theme like Earthquake Risk in the Country & its Mitigation Measures by Prof. CVR Murty, IIT Madras followed by Earthquake Monitoring Activities by Dr. G. Suresh, Scientist F and Ms. Reeta Sandhilya, Secretary, Revenue of Chhattisgarh made a presentation on Earthquake Risk Mitigation Measures in their State.

The 3rd technical session was chaired by Nikunja Bihari Dhal, IAS, Principal Secretary, Health & FW Department, Govt. of Odisha.  Three presentations were made on the theme like Health Emergency Preparedness in the country by Dr. Saurabh Dalal, NDMA followed by presentation by Bihar and Odisha on Health Emergency Preparedness by Sh. Thyagarajan, DM, Darbhanga and Ms. Yamini Sadangi, IAS, (MD, Odisha State Medical Corporation) respectively.
